#17b605 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#17b605 is composed of 9% red, 71.4%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.3%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 113.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.7% and a lightness of 36.7%. #17b605 color hex could be obtained by blending #2eff0a with #006d00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

#17b605 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#17b605 has RGB values of R:23, G:182,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.97,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 1553925.

Hex triplet 17b605 #17b605
RGB Decimal 23, 182, 5 rgb(23,182,5)
RGB Percent 9, 71.4, 2 rgb(9%,71.4%,2%)
CMYK 87, 0, 97, 29
HSL 113.9°, 94.7, 36.7 hsl(113.9,94.7%,36.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 113.9°, 97.3, 71.4
Web Safe 00cc00 #00cc00
CIE-LAB 64.681, -65.458, 64.13
XYZ 17.108, 33.647, 5.736
xyY 0.303, 0.596, 33.647
CIE-LCH 64.681, 91.637, 135.587
CIE-LUV 64.681, -59.605, 78.59
Hunter-Lab 58.006, -48.866, 34.741
Binary 00010111, 10110110, 00000101

Shades and Tints of #17b605

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a00 is the darkest color, while #f7fff6 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#17b605 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#727272 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#60805c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#b5a200 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#c99a30 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#5dadba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#7ca901 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#88a420 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#44b078 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
